Summary:Recent developments in computer-aided modeling and simulation of complex materials systems involve three components. First, those basic tools of thermodynamics, state equations, must be revisited. Second, the new physical parameters of materials modeling require the increased data precision obtainable by recent physical and analytical instrumentation. Finally, we urgently need to create highly specialized databases as tools for quality assessment, correlation and prediction. This book includes concrete examples in metalurgy, polymers, composites, solutions and gels - all currently relevant and important for materials scientists and engineers. It examines the behavior of new materials and their complex synthesis processes. The growing importance of CAD methodology in Material Sciences is clearly identified. CAD contributions are viewed here dynamically, e.g. in the context of the materials life cycle.
